I tackle my eggnog rice pudding recipe as I would a risotto: constant watching to make sure that the milk doesn’t dry up and that my pudding is creamy. If you want to impress your guest for the holidays, read along!

INGREDIENTS
This recipe makes about 4 servings.
- 3/4 cup of long grain rice
- 1 1/2 cups of water
- 1 1/2 cups of Eggnog
- Pinch of salt
- 2 tablespoons of sugar
- 3/4 cup of milk
- Handful of Sultana Raisin
- Cinnamon for serving

INSTRUCTIONS:
- In a medium saucepan, bring the water to a boil. Add in the rice and salt, and reduce the heat. Simmer until the water is absorbed- for about 20 minutes.
- Add in the milk, sugar. Let it cook for about 15 minutes.
- Stirring frequently, slowly add in the eggnog until the mixture is creamy. Cook for about 10 minutes
- Add in a handful of raisins. Cook for a few minutes, still stirring frequently.
- Remove from heat and let it cool for about 5-10 minutes.
- Serve in bowls or glasses of your choice.
- Sprinkle a little cinnamon and Enjoy!
